  "textContent": "Ship tracking services say at least three Iranian oil tankers, carrying about five million barrels of oil, have passed through the former U.S. blockade line since President Donald Trump announced his ceasefire deal with Tehran on Sunday.\n\nThe post Iranian Oil Tankers Pass U.S. Blockade Line After Ceasefire Deal Announced appeared first on Breitbart.",
